Pros and cons mastic vs thinset.
In a perfect world all tile jobs would be done with thinset.
In the specific example of retiling a backsplash the tile will be placed over drywall and the choice of mortar or adhesive depends on the type of tile.
If installing a large amount of tiles stone tiles or glass tiles thinset mortar should be used.
Thinset is ultimately stronger and unaffected by water.
Thinset can be used for showers bathtubs backsplashes and other areas.
